Overview and Quick History
Academic Decathlon Scores and Information Center (ADSIC) is a website utilizing the MediaWiki software whose purpose is to store results from various levels of Academic Decathlon competitions.
ADSIC (originally AcaDec Scores(ADS)) is the brain child of Kort Jackson and David Gilman. ADS was originally headed by Phil Cerami but was closed due to spam issues. After a few months time, Jackson and Gilman launched ADSIC with Gilman handling all the programming aspects of the projects.
